Shielded Twisted Pair (STP)

Updated: 2026-07-22

Overview

Shielded Twisted Pair (STP) cable is a specialized networking cable designed for environments with significant electromagnetic interference. The 'two-pair' configuration refers to its two sets of twisted copper conductors, each individually shielded and then collectively shielded again. This dual shielding provides superior protection against external noise compared to unshielded alternatives. STP cables are particularly valuable in industrial settings, healthcare facilities, and data centers where electrical equipment generates substantial interference. The twisting of conductor pairs helps cancel out electromagnetic interference, while the metallic shielding provides additional protection against both incoming and outgoing signal disruption.

Structure and Working Principle

The STP cable's construction features four copper conductors arranged as two twisted pairs. Each pair is wrapped in an aluminum foil shield, with an overall braided shield encompassing all pairs. Some variants may use different shielding combinations like foil-only or braid-only designs depending on application requirements. The working principle relies on three key elements: the twisted pair configuration cancels common-mode interference through differential signaling, the individual pair shields prevent crosstalk between pairs, and the overall shield protects against external electromagnetic interference. Proper grounding of the shield is essential for optimal performance, typically achieved through specialized connectors.

Key Features

STP cables offer several distinct advantages in challenging electrical environments. Their superior EMI/RFI protection makes them ideal for installations near heavy machinery, medical equipment, or power lines. The shielding also provides better security against signal eavesdropping compared to unshielded cables. Modern STP cables often feature low-smoke zero-halogen (LSZH) jackets for safety in enclosed spaces. They're available in various AWG sizes (typically 22-26 AWG) with different shielding configurations (F/UTP, S/FTP, etc.) to suit specific installation requirements. High-quality STP cables maintain consistent impedance (usually 100 ohms) to ensure signal integrity.

Application Areas

STP cables find extensive use in industrial automation systems where motors and high-power equipment create significant electrical noise. They're mandatory in many healthcare settings for medical equipment connectivity and patient monitoring systems where signal reliability is critical. Data centers increasingly use STP cables for high-speed network backbones, particularly in 10GbE and higher implementations. They're also common in military applications, broadcast facilities, and any environment requiring secure data transmission with minimal interference risk.

Maintenance and Precautions

Proper STP cable maintenance begins with correct installation practices. Avoid sharp bends that can damage the shielding, and maintain the minimum recommended bend radius (typically 4x the cable diameter). Use only compatible shielded connectors and ensure proper grounding throughout the system. Periodic inspections should check for shield integrity, particularly at connection points. When running multiple STP cables, maintain separation from power cables (minimum 12 inches recommended). In corrosive environments, consider cables with additional protective jackets or conduit installation.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ring STP cables in bulk, verify compliance with relevant standards like ISO/IEC 11801, TIA/EIA-568, or industry-specific requirements. Key specifications to confirm include shielding effectiveness (dB rating), bandwidth capacity, and fire safety ratings. For large installations, request samples to test termination ease and flexibility. Consider total cost of ownership including installation labor - some high-end STP cables feature easier-to-terminate designs that reduce labor costs. For reference, bulk pricing for commercial-grade STP typically ranges from $0.50 to $2.00 per meter depending on specifications and order volume.
